Output 7705c6c48a32b0a8bfb02ef20e9e2fca2841bd54805b3ab60da73acedc5403a3:19

value
30569229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4c83e0f50655a53b731404edbe2d5451eb1a7a0 OP_EQUAL
address
MRqeZ7hSVfvrVJS78hU3w5q1u4fXfLy1oy
transaction
7705c6c48a32b0a8bfb02ef20e9e2fca2841bd54805b3ab60da73acedc5403a3
spent
true